1. Age RequirementsMost car rental companies in Addison require drivers to be at least 21 years old. Drivers under 25 may be subject to a young driver surcharge.
2. Driver’s License & DocumentationA valid driver's license is required. International visitors may need an International Driving Permit (IDP) along with their home country license.
3. Insurance & DepositsRental agreements typically include basic insurance. Additional coverage options, such as collision damage waiver (CDW), are available. A security deposit is usually required, held on a credit card.
4. Mileage & Fuel PolicyMileage policies vary; unlimited mileage options are often available. Fuel policies generally require returning the car with the same fuel level as when it was picked up to avoid extra charges.
5. Additional FeesAdditional fees may apply for optional add-ons, such as GPS navigation, child seats, or additional drivers.

Gas Stations in Addison
Convenient Locations
Numerous gas stations are located along major roads, such as Belt Line Road and Addison Road.
Major Brands
You can find brands like Shell, Chevron, ExxonMobil, and Texaco easily.
24-Hour Availability
Many gas stations offer 24-hour service for your convenience.

Major Bus Stations
Addison Transit Center
Serves as a hub for local bus routes, providing connections throughout Addison and surrounding areas.
Airports
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port (DFW)
Located approximately 20 miles from Addison, DFW is a major international airport serving numerous domestic and international destinations.
Dallas Love Field (DAL)
Situated about 10 miles from Addison, Dallas Love Field primarily serves Southwest Airlines and other domestic carriers.
